  • On June 16th,2007, El Sobrante Christian High School graduated its first class of high school seniors...a very exciting event for all of us!
  •    After a diligent and thorough process, the WASC (Western Association of Schools and Colleges) and ACSI (Association of Christian Schools International) approved dual accreditation for the entire K-12 program at El Sobrante Christian Schools.
        This is an incredible step of encouragement and validation to all the staff, students, parents and families that are part of the ESCS community. Thank you and congratulations to all of you!
